Essential Duties and Responsibilities:
Benefits Administration
- Administer and manage employee benefits programs, including medical, dental, vision, life insurance, disability, retirement plans, and wellness initiatives.
- Process enrollments, terminations, and employee changes while ensuring accuracy and compliance with plan requirements.
- Assist in benefits-related employee communications, including open enrollment planning and execution, benefit education sessions, and new hire orientation materials.
- Work closely with vendors and third-party administrators to resolve benefits-related issues and provide timely responses to employee inquiries.
- Conduct regular audits of benefits records to ensure accuracy and compliance.
- Support compliance efforts, ensuring adherence to ACA reporting, COBRA notifications, and ERISA guidelines.
Leave of Absence Administration
- Oversee and manage FMLA, ADA, short-term disability, long-term disability, workers’ compensation, and personal leaves of absence.
- Serve as the primary point of contact for employees, managers, and HR representatives regarding leave eligibility, processes, and accommodations.
- Ensure compliance with all applicable federal, state, and tribal leave laws, maintaining accurate leave documentation and records.
- Partner with HR, payroll, and legal teams to facilitate return-to-work processes, reasonable accommodations, and leave tracking.
- Provide training and guidance to managers regarding leave policies, ADA accommodations, and best practices for supporting employees on leave.
Data Analysis & Compliance
- Analyze benefits utilization trends, costs, and employee participation to provide recommendations for improvements and cost-saving opportunities.
- Maintain accurate HRIS benefits data, ensuring proper documentation and reporting for audits and compliance purposes.
- Generate and analyze reports related to benefits costs, leave trends, and workforce planning.
- Stay updated on changes in federal, state, and tribal employment laws that may impact benefits and leave policies, making recommendations for updates as necessary.
Employee Support & Communication
- Provide direct employee support for benefit plan inquiries, claims assistance, and leave administration.
- Develop and deliver educational resources, including FAQs, guides, and presentations, to enhance employee understanding of benefits and leave programs.
- Collaborate with HR leadership to improve benefits offerings and increase employee engagement in wellness and benefits programs.
Minimum Qualifications:
- Bachelor’s degree in Human Resources, Business Administration, or a related field.
- Minimum of three (3) years of experience in HR, benefits administration, or leave management.
- Strong knowledge of leave administration processes, compliance requirements, and benefits regulations.
- Advanced proficiency in HRIS platforms, Microsoft Excel (pivot tables, VLOOKUPs, and reporting tools), and data analysis.
- Ability to analyze data, identify trends, and provide insights for decision-making.
- Excellent problem-solving, organizational, and time-management skills with high attention to detail.
- Ability to maintain confidentiality and handle sensitive employee information with discretion.
- Strong interpersonal and communication skills with the ability to interact effectively across all levels of the organization.
Preferred Qualifications:
- HR certification (PHR, SHRM-CP, CEBS) preferred.
- Experience working with benefits vendors and third-party administrators.
- Familiarity with self-funded benefit plans and wellness program initiatives.
- Understanding of tribal law and its impact on employee benefits and leave policies is a plus.
- Experience working in tribal organizations, gaming, healthcare, or hospitality industries is preferred.
